Abstract
We discuss the physics potential of future tritium β-decay experiments having a sensitivity to a neutrino mass â¼|Îm232|â¼5Ã10â2eV. The case of three-neutrino mixing is analyzed. A negative result of such an experiment would imply that the neutrino mass spectrum is of normal hierarchical type. The interpretation of a positive result would depend on the value of the lightest neutrino mass; if the lightest neutrino mass satisfies the inequality min(mj)âª|Îm232|, it would imply that the neutrino mass spectrum is of the inverted hierarchical type.
